Book excerpt: The transition from school to vocational education is of different quality and performance in the diverse national VET systems and heavily determined by the different structures of governance in the national education and VET systems. In September 2009, the International Network on Innovative Apprenticeship (INAP) hosted its third international conference in Turin bringing together leading researchers in the area of international TVET research. This book summarises all topics discussed within the frame of the Turin conference and overviews current research and analysis in the following fields: Managing successful transitions from school to work * Building vocational identity * Competence evaluation and development in VET * Levels of governance and the role of stakeholders in apprenticeships
